What are Rhondda Cynon Taf County Borough Council's skip permit rules?
A skip permit is required whenever the skip sits on a public road, pavement or grass verge in Aberdare / Aberdâr. The fee is £41.60 for 14 days, with at least 2 working days' notice typically needed. Skips on private property (driveway, front garden, off-street parking) don't need a permit. A permit can be arranged on your behalf when you book.
Apply for a skip permit in Aberdare / Aberdâr (Rhondda Cynon Taf County Borough Council) ↗Rhondda Cynon Taf County Borough Council skip permit fees (official source) ↗
- Rhondda Cynon Taf County Borough Council typically requires at least 2 working days' notice before a road permit is granted.
- Don't overfill; skips must be loaded level with the top edge, or collection may be refused.
- Cones and night-time lighting may be required under the permit conditions; check at booking.
- Hire periods run 7 to 14 days as standard, with renewals available at £41.60.

Wait-and-load
Where a permit or driveway isn't an option in Aberdare / Aberdâr, wait-and-load is the practical solution. The lorry arrives, the skip stays on the vehicle while you load it, then both leave together in a single visit.

How is skip waste collected in Aberdare / Aberdâr processed?
Get a priceSorting at a licensed transfer station
Skip loads from Aberdare / Aberdâr are processed through licensed transfer stations serving the local area. Each load is tipped and sorted by material type: wood, metal, hardcore, plasterboard, clean plastics and mixed residue are all separated for onward handling.
Compliance with waste regulations
A waste carrier licence, registered with Natural Resources Wales, underpins every booking. Each skip hire order automatically generates a waste transfer note, keeping you compliant with duty-of-care obligations under the Environmental Protection Act 1990.
Recycling and landfill
From Aberdare / Aberdâr, sorted skip waste travels to UK recycling facilities. Smelters handle metal, biomass plants take wood, and hardcore goes for aggregate re-use. Only genuinely non-recoverable residue is sent to landfill. Around 90% of UK skip waste is recycled or recovered (WRAP UK, 2023).
